A direct current generator serves as a reliable source of power, especially in remote areas where access to the grid is limited. These generators convert mechanical energy into electrical energy, providing a steady supply of current. Their simplicity and efficiency make them ideal for various applications, from powering tools on job sites to serving as backup power in emergencies. An alternating current dynamo is essential for producing electrical energy in many industrial applications. Known for their ability to generate electricity efficiently, these dynamos are widely used in power plants and manufacturing settings. By utilizing an alternating current dynamo, you can benefit from its capacity to produce higher voltages, which is vital for long-distance transmission. When selecting between a direct current generator and an alternating current dynamo, consider your specific needs. A direct current generator is often preferred for portable applications, while an alternating current dynamo is better suited for larger, stationary setups requiring consistent power.
